RVM Expands e-Discovery consulting practice through acquisition of EDiscover-E

March 28th, 2012

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E

New York, NY—March 28, 2012—RVM, a leading provider of litigation support and corporate solutions, announces its acquisition of litigation consulting firm, EDiscover-e. This acquisition will enhance RVM’s growing suite of electronic discovery services, adding a best practice section concentrating on corporate litigation readiness, e-Discovery response process, and individual case management.

EDiscover-e, an electronic discovery consulting firm based in Columbus, Ohio concentrates on in-depth analysis of corporate and law firm e-Discovery current processes and procedures. EDiscover-e specializes in understanding the corporate culture and creating defensible, repeatable internal processes geared toward minimizing the risk and reducing the cost associated with electronic discovery.

“We are excited about the combined talent of RVM and EDiscover-e Inc. within the professional services offering,” states Vinnie Brunetti, President and CEO. RVM has increased the level of expertise in an area that our clients find the most challenging. There is a demand for seasoned professionals to help corporations address the daunting tasks of scoping for litigation hold, preservation and collection caused by the ever increasing amount of data sources as technology continues to evolve.

We understand the demands made on General Counsel and IT to get costs under control. However, with the voluminous amounts of data on devices, these types of tasks outpace the allocated or internal resources that many corporations have available to tackle these projects. “With the combination of RVM and EDiscover-e’s e-Discovery professionals, we excel in assisting corporations through all phases of these processes,” states Vinnie Brunetti.

Now, with the infusion of EDiscover-e, RVM has augmented both its expertise, and the scope of its Mid-West presence, specifically in Columbus, OH, Cincinnati, OH, Pittsburgh, PA, and Indianapolis, IN.

“The combination of RVM’s forensic collection and processing expertise, best of breed analytical and review tools with the experienced consultants of EDiscover-e will enable RVM to deliver services customized at the client matter level. This combination will allow solutions, tailored to the dynamics of a specific organization, its people, processes and technologies. Our process involves analyzing those internal factors and how to leverage them for mitigating risks, improving efficiencies and reducing e-Discovery costs,” added David Porter, Senior e-Discovery Consultant for RVM, formerly Managing Partner, EDiscover-e.

As best-in-class providers RVM and EDiscover-e continually strive to enhance their offerings to meet the dynamic needs of their clients. By joining forces, two best-in-class providers just got better.

About RVM

RVM provides litigation support worldwide and has offices in New York, NY, Chicago, IL and Cleveland, Ohio. RVM’s proprietary e-Data processing tool, Revelation™ tackles challenging data sources such as Bloomberg, Lotus Notes with enhanced functionality where others fall short. RVM also provides premium hosting services through the Relativity and Clearwell platforms, allowing clients to engage RVM for comprehensive and efficient end-to-end litigation support.

RVM: Here We GROW Again!

March 20th, 2012

eDiscovery

RVM is thrilled to announce its unprecedented level of growth, resulting in the need to procure much larger quarters. Come March 23rd RVM will settle into its new spacious facility in downtown Manhattan, at 40 Rector Street, on the Seventeenth Floor. RVM’s 40 Rector Street Team has diligently set the stage for the transition, which involved retrofitting some 30,000 square feet to accommodate RVM’s growth pattern. This follows RVM’s 2011 accolade of landing a spot on Inc. Magazine’s Top 5000 Fastest Growing Companies of 2010.

RVM’s newfound space will allow for enhanced client service, replete with numerous private offices, several conference rooms, and technological upgrades.  This coupled with the growth rate of the organization will increase RVM’s bandwidth as a top tier provider of  e-Discovery and Litigation Support Services.
